What is a Memorandum Of Settlement?

The Memorandum of Settlement is a crucial document used in Singapore's legal landscape when parties wish to formally document the resolution of their disputes. This document is particularly relevant when parties have reached an agreement through negotiation, mediation, or other forms of alternative dispute resolution. It captures all essential terms of the settlement, including financial arrangements, mutual releases, and ongoing obligations. The document must comply with Singapore's legal requirements and can be enforced through the Singapore courts if necessary. A well-drafted Memorandum of Settlement helps prevent future disputes by clearly documenting the agreed terms and ensuring all parties understand their rights and obligations.

About the Memorandum Of Settlement

When you're involved in a dispute in Singapore, reaching a settlement agreement is often the most practical and cost-effective resolution. A Memorandum Of Settlement serves as the formal legal document that records the terms you've agreed upon, creating a binding contract that can be enforced through Singapore's court system if necessary.

When do you need this document?

You'll need a Memorandum Of Settlement whenever you've reached an agreement to resolve a dispute outside of court proceedings. This commonly occurs after successful mediation sessions, direct negotiations between parties, or settlement conferences. The document is essential in commercial disputes, employment conflicts, partnership disagreements, and personal injury claims. You should also use this document when you want to avoid the uncertainty, cost, and time associated with litigation, or when you've participated in court-annexed mediation and reached a resolution.

Key legal considerations

Your Memorandum Of Settlement must include comprehensive release provisions that clearly define which claims each party is waiving. You need to specify the exact payment terms, including amounts, timing, and method of payment, as these become legally enforceable obligations. The document should detail any ongoing duties or restrictions, such as confidentiality clauses or non-compete agreements. You must ensure that all parties have the legal capacity to enter into the settlement and that any corporate parties have proper authorization. Consider including dispute resolution mechanisms for any future disagreements about the settlement terms themselves, and be aware that once signed, the agreement typically prevents you from pursuing the same claims in court.

Legal requirements in Singapore

Under Singapore law, your Memorandum Of Settlement must comply with the Civil Law Act and general contract law principles derived from English common law. If your settlement arose from mediation, the Mediation Act 2017 provides additional enforceability protections, allowing you to apply to court for enforcement if the other party breaches the agreement. The document must be in writing and signed by all parties to be legally binding. For employment-related settlements, you must ensure compliance with the Employment Act, particularly regarding notice periods and compensation calculations. Corporate parties must have proper board resolutions or authority documentation. The Evidence Act governs how your settlement agreement can be used in any future legal proceedings, so proper execution and witnessing may be important depending on your circumstances.

GOVERNING LAW

Applicable law

This Memorandum Of Settlement is drafted to comply with Singapore law. Key legislation includes:

Civil Law Act (Cap. 43): Primary legislation governing civil law matters in Singapore, providing the fundamental framework for contract law and civil obligations

Contract Law: Based on English common law principles, governs the formation, execution, and enforcement of contracts in Singapore

Mediation Act 2017: Governs mediation proceedings in Singapore and provides framework for enforcing mediated settlement agreements

Evidence Act (Cap. 97): Regulates the admissibility of evidence in legal proceedings, including documentary evidence of settlements

Employment Act (Cap. 91): Main employment law that sets out basic terms and conditions for workers in Singapore, relevant for employment-related settlements

Industrial Relations Act (Cap. 136): Governs industrial relations and collective bargaining processes between employers and trade unions

Employment Claims Act 2016: Establishes framework for resolving salary-related disputes and claims between employers and employees

Workplace Safety and Health Act: Regulates workplace safety and health standards, relevant for settlements involving workplace incidents

Supreme Court of Judicature Act: Establishes the jurisdiction and powers of Singapore courts in handling civil matters and settlements

Rules of Court: Procedural rules governing court proceedings and settlement procedures in Singapore

Limitation Act (Cap. 163): Sets time limits for bringing legal actions and claims, affecting settlement timeframes

Stamp Duties Act (Cap. 312): Governs stamp duty requirements for legal documents including settlement agreements

Personal Data Protection Act 2012: Regulates the collection, use, and disclosure of personal data, relevant for confidentiality and data protection in settlements

Income Tax Act: Governs taxation implications of settlement payments and compensation in Singapore
